Commercial Slab Installation in Williamsburg, VA

Commercial slab installation services involve preparing and pouring concrete foundations for various types of structures, including retail spaces, warehouses, garages, and other commercial properties. This process typically includes site preparation, form construction, reinforcement placement, and concrete pouring to create a durable, level surface that supports building structures or heavy equipment. Property owners usually seek this service to ensure a solid foundation for their projects, improve property value, or facilitate future construction efforts.

Before requesting commercial slab installation, property owners often want to understand the scope of the project, including site conditions, the type of concrete mix used, and the estimated lifespan of the slab. It’s also important to consider factors such as load-bearing requirements, drainage, and local building codes. Clear communication about project expectations and any specific structural needs can help ensure the installation meets the long-term needs of the property.

Project Types

Common Commercial Slab Installation Jobs

Commercial slab installation involves pouring concrete foundations for retail, office, or industrial buildings.

Parking lot slabs provide durable surfaces for vehicle traffic and parking areas.

Sidewalk and walkway slabs create safe, level pathways around commercial properties.

Loading dock slabs support heavy equipment and frequent freight movement.

Foundation slabs serve as the base for new commercial structures or expansions.

Retaining wall slabs help manage land elevation changes around commercial sites.

Commercial Slab Installation Questions

What types of projects require commercial slab installation? Commercial slab installation is often needed for retail spaces, warehouses, parking lots, and industrial buildings to provide a durable foundation or surface.

What materials are commonly used for commercial slabs? Concrete is the most common material for commercial slabs due to its strength and longevity, though other options may include specialized mixes for specific needs.

How does site preparation affect commercial slab installation? Proper site preparation, including grading and soil stabilization, ensures the slab remains level and prevents cracking or shifting over time.

What should property owners consider before installing a commercial slab? It's important to evaluate the intended use, load requirements, and drainage needs to select the appropriate slab design and thickness.
